2613. "Resist this temptation: you are being tested in this. Do not follow after the semi-Egyptian Siimiri, but obey me." 2614. The Bible story makes Aaron the culprit, which is inconsistent with his office as the high priest of Allah and the right hand of Moses. See n. 1116 to vii. 150. Our version is more consistent, and explains in the Siimiri the lingering influences of the Egyptian cult of Osiris the bull-god. 2615. Obviously Aaron's speech in the last verse. and the rebels' defiance in this verse, were spoken before the return of Moses from the Mount. 2616. The rebels had so little faith that they had given Moses up for lost, and never expected to see him again. 2617. Moses, when he came back, was full of anger and grief. His speech to Aaron is one of rebuke, and he was also inclined to handle him roughly: see next verse. Thc order he refcrs to is that stated in vii. 142, "Act for me amongst my people: do right, and follow not the way of those who do mischief." 2618.
